APP下载

计算机视觉系统框架结构探讨

2015-12-13牛天瑜

科技传播 2015年15期
关键词:信息处理三维重建物体

牛天瑜

黑龙江农垦管理干部学院,黑龙江哈尔滨 150090

计算机视觉系统框架结构探讨

牛天瑜

黑龙江农垦管理干部学院,黑龙江哈尔滨 150090

随着科学技术的发展,人工智能已经逐步走进了我们的生活,计算机视觉系统的发展日渐成熟,计算机系统一方面帮助人们更好的完善人类视觉的隐藏功能,另一方面也让人们更好的理解了人们视觉形成的原理,模拟人类的视觉形成,计算机视觉系统框架对于计算机视觉的发展有着不可取代的作用,本文综合分析了计算机视觉系统框架的,对其未来的发展提出了一些新的思路。

计算机;视觉系统;框架结构

21世纪是个智能化的时代,计算机技术已经渗透到人们生活的各个领域,包括教育、科学、工程等,70年代中期人们提出了计算机视觉理论,计算机和视觉根据二维图像反应的内容对物体及其场景进行描述,充分扩展了人类的视觉功能,随着计算机视觉系统的发展逐渐出现了三种框架,包括计算机视觉理论,基于知识的视觉理论和主动视觉理论。计算机视觉系统是一个极富有挑战性的领域,增强了视觉效果。

1 计算机视觉系统理论框架

1.1 三维重建理论框架

美国科学家D·Marr教授最先开始提出三维重建理论框架,三维重建框架理论是把视觉过程通过信息处理技术转变为信息过程,在转变过程中进行三维重建,作用计算机处理技术从三个方面对人类视觉系统进行模拟,分别为理论方面,表示方面和算法方面,创造出了与人类视觉系统所不同的全新视觉过程,计算机在某些程度上有着比人类大脑更快更精确的信息处理能力,通过视觉获取二维图像,在信息转换处理中模拟出三维结构,推测出物体三维中的位置,扩展了人类的视觉范围,使人类可以从看到更加丰富的二维三维图像。

1.2 主动视觉理论框架

主动视觉理论框架是较为成熟的理论框架,框架包括选择注意点、控制凝视点、手与眼相配合,将视觉融入机器人结构,这充分体现了主动视觉理论框架要求人的视觉与四肢活动相协调,也与三维重建的框架有着明显的区别,人的视觉具有主观能动性,人会自己的需要调节视角获取图像信息,人眼的视野范围很大,但是在我们并不会注意到全部事物,而是信息经过大脑的信息处理对一些感兴趣的场景加以特别注意,是基于目的的主动视觉理论,根据视觉的主观要求,设置摄像机的各项参数和观察点,使其完成特定视觉目的,调节摄像机的位置,焦距等数据使摄像机对想选择的特定点进行感知。控制机制分为锁定和转移,锁定是只对需要的目标进行跟踪,转移是继续锁定下一步的关注点

1.3 基于知识的视觉理论框架

基于知识的视觉理论框架是指人类的视觉系统可以自动的将二元物体和三元物体进行转换,计算机的视觉系统与人类视觉系统的不同之处是在于它根据人的视觉系统来模拟但是可以直接对二维物体的信息进行处理,省略转换步骤,实现二维向三维的直接跨越,提高了计算机系统的工作效率,基于知识的视觉理论框架,很大程度上推动了计算机视觉系统的发展,视觉系统发挥视觉作用是不需要三维计算的,对于计算机模仿人类视觉功能没有实质性帮助作用。极大的增加了计算机视觉系统信息处理的效率。构建基于知识的视觉理论框架,对计算机视觉系统的发展具有重要的推动作用。

2 构建计算机视觉系统框架新思路

计算机视觉系统是计算机与人结合的重要进步,计算机视觉系统框架对于计算机视觉的研究有着指导意义,计算机系统框架包括三维重建理论框架、主动视觉理论框架以及基于知识的视觉理论框架等计算机视觉系统理论框架,三种框架有着各自不同的目的,三维重建理论框架将视觉以三维重建为目的,主动视觉理论框架则以人的主观意识来进行特定的选择,基于知识的理论框架可以根据知识的引导实现二维向三维的转换,三种视觉理论框架有着各自独特的优势,同时也存在着一定的缺陷和不足。在其发展的过程中,弊端也逐渐暴露出来,在对这些缺陷和不足进行完善改进的过程当中,计算机视觉系统框架开始根据新的发展思路进行构建,以满足时代发展的要求。

2.1 早期处理

由于计算机视觉系统依赖着计算机技术的发展,所以计算机技术的好坏很大程度影响着计算机视觉系统,21世纪以来,我们国家在计算机领域取得了瞩目的成就,人工智能已开始应用于各个领域,但目前计算机视觉系统作为发展不成熟的领域,它的完善很大程度取决于计算机视觉系统功能,图像的早期处理是计算机视觉系统的重要组成部分,也是根本步骤,从早期视觉处理开始,包括对图像进行的预处理、图像的分割以及图像的二维识别,完成上述步骤后再进行简单的处理,就能使图像处理结果达到事半功倍的效果,可见早期处理对于图像质量的重要性,早期处理完成后,需要开始进行中后期的处理,后续步骤是实现二维和三维模式识别的重要步骤,也是将二维和三维加以区别的必不可少的步骤,对二维和三维的信息进行整合处理,迅速做出反应,极大的丰富了计算机视觉系统的功能,早期处理作为基本步骤之一,它的完成对后面的程序有着铺垫的作用。注重图像的早期处理可从根本上提升图像的质量。

2.2 模型库的建设

计算机视觉系统的运行需要依赖特定的物体才可以进行,并不是凭空想象出来的物体而是以具体的物体为原型,将各种物体的信息记录下来形成模型库,将所建立的模型库与视觉信息库结合起来,即可实现对物体进行抽象性表达,计算机视觉系统也模仿人类获取知识的行为进行信息采集,称为模型库,并根据计算机视觉系统对视觉信息处理整合,将其归纳到信息库当中。模型库和信息库的建立,贮存了大量的视觉信息,使计算机可以产生各种视觉效果,丰富了人类所看到的世界,信息的分类整合提高了计算机视觉系统的工作效率,让计算机更快速高效的完成图像的处理,极大的提高了计算机视觉系统的工作效率,完善了计算机视觉系统。

2.3 结合现实实际

人类的视觉系统在进行视觉感知活动当中,往往是根据个人需要以及视觉范围内的物体来决定的,具有一定的目的性。对所处的环境和场景,对其中存在的物品的视觉记忆,渐进式的进行恢复。这是计算机视觉系统新的发展方向,是更加接近于人类视觉系统模拟,在视觉信息处理过程当中,能够获得更加完整和清新的图像。真正与实际相互结合,将人类的视觉活动更加准确的“移植”到计算机视觉系统框架结构当中,真正满足人工智能的发展需求,可以更好的替代人体来进行视觉活动。使计算机视觉系统更加形象准确的进行视觉信息处理,对计算机视觉系统框架结构的改进与创新具有重要的意义。

3 结论

计算机功能的拓展和完善,在多个领域的应用当中有着良好的体现。人工智能是计算机技术一个新的发展应用,计算机视觉系统是一个新的发展方向,形成对人体视觉功能的模拟,建立模拟库和信息库,建立计算机视觉系统构架。其主要功能是替人类执行和分担需要发挥视觉功能的工作。提升工作效率,节约了人力资源。使人类看到更加充实的世界,通过三种视觉理论系统的构建,根据计算机视觉系统发展新思路,对计算机视觉系统结构框架进行完善,极大的推动了计算机视觉系统发展。

[1]田思,袁占亭.计算机视觉系统框架的新构思[J].计算机工程与应用,2012(6).

[2]王天珍.计算机视觉研究[J].空军雷达学院学报,2009(1).

TP3

A

1674-6708(2015)144-0102-01

猜你喜欢

信息处理三维重建物体
东营市智能信息处理实验室
基于Revit和Dynamo的施工BIM信息处理
基于Mimics的CT三维重建应用分析
深刻理解物体的平衡
地震烈度信息处理平台研究
我们是怎样看到物体的
CTCS-3级列控系统RBC与ATP结合部异常信息处理
基于关系图的无人机影像三维重建
三维重建结合3D打印技术在腔镜甲状腺手术中的临床应用
多排螺旋CT三维重建在颌面部美容中的应用